To clarify on the New Republic:

It was just the capital (the senate) and the fleet that were destroyed. Altho I guess for all intents and purposes, the New Republic is destroyed.

Also after Jedi, according to the Aftermath novel, the Republic and the Empire agreed to disarm. The Resistance is like the undercover, black ops version of the Republic army (since the Republic has no army). They secretly get support from the Republic (as Hux mentions in the film), but they are not an official army.
